Beware of Deepfake Job Candidates!

Recruiters and hiring managers — be alert! Some candidates are now using AI-generated deepfake videos or voice during virtual interviews to pose as someone else.

Tips:

Verify identities early.

Use video interviews with live prompts.

Watch for delays, mismatched lip movements, or unnatural voice.

Stay sharp — technology is evolving, and so are hiring scams!

FTC Votes to Ban Non-Compete Clauses, Empowering Employees in the Job Market

In a landmark decision, the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) has voted to ban non-compete clauses, a move set to revolutionize the employment landscape and empower workers across various industries. Non-compete clauses have long been a source of contention, imposing restrictions on employees' ability to seek employment with competitors after leaving their current position. However, with the new FTC agreement, employees now have unprecedented freedom in the job market, marking a significant victory for labor rights advocates.

Non-compete clauses, often included in employment contracts, have historically placed stringent limitations on employees' career mobility. These clauses typically prevent workers from joining rival companies or engaging in similar work within a specific geographic area for a designated period after leaving their current job. While initially intended to protect businesses' proprietary information and prevent unfair competition, non-compete clauses have increasingly come under scrutiny for their potential to stifle innovation, hinder wage growth, and limit job opportunities for workers.

The FTC's decision to ban non-compete clauses represents a significant departure from the status quo and marks a pivotal moment for employee rights. By eliminating these restrictive contracts, the FTC aims to foster a more competitive and dynamic job market, where workers can freely pursue opportunities that align with their skills, experience, and career aspirations. The move is expected to unleash a wave of innovation and entrepreneurship, as workers are no longer shackled by the fear of legal reprisal for seeking employment with competitors.

The removal of non-compete clauses is set to have far-reaching implications for wage negotiation and salary transparency. With employees no longer bound by restrictive employment contracts, they are better positioned to negotiate higher salaries, improved benefits, and more favorable working conditions. The newfound freedom to explore job opportunities without fear of retribution empowers workers to assert their value in the labor market and demand fair compensation for their contributions.

In addition to benefiting individual workers, the FTC's decision to ban non-compete clauses is expected to yield broader economic benefits. By fostering a more fluid job market where talent can move freely between employers, the decision promotes innovation, fosters competition, and drives productivity growth. Furthermore, the removal of barriers to labor mobility is likely to enhance labor market efficiency, reduce income inequality, and stimulate economic development.

Empowering Veteran Entrepreneurs: The Texas Veteran Entrepreneur Program

Texas has a long-standing tradition of honoring and supporting its veterans, and the state continues to demonstrate its commitment through initiatives like the Texas Veteran Entrepreneur Program. With the recent reinstatement of the New Veteran-Owned Business statute, Texas is providing significant incentives to veterans looking to start their own businesses. Corporate Recruitment Solutions, LLC is a proud participant in the program.

The New Veteran-Owned Business Statute: A Game Changer

In the 87th Legislature, Regular Session, Senate Bill 938 brought about a transformative change for veteran entrepreneurs in Texas. Effective from January 1, 2022, the New Veteran-Owned Business statute offers a compelling waiver that has the potential to change the landscape for veteran-owned business entities in Texas.

Formation Fee Relief: Veterans can save anywhere from $300 (for LLCs or corporations) to $750 (for professional associations or limited partnerships). This financial relief at the inception of their business endeavors can make a significant difference.

Five Years of Tax Exemption: The five-year exemption from the Texas franchise tax further eases the financial burden on veteran-owned businesses. This tax reprieve enables these businesses to reinvest in growth, development, and employment opportunities.
